ASCs in a Post COVID Pandemic World

Clay Countryman, JD

Breazeale, Sachse & Wilson

This presentation will discuss some of the primary challenges faced by Ambulatory Surgery Centers as Louisiana and the country becomes increasingly “vaccinated” against COVID-19. Some of the legal and regulatory issues that will be discussed include:

  • Compliance with evolving Federal and state COVID-19 guidance and requirements
  • ASC Mergers and Acquisitions involving hospitals and Private Equity investors
  • ASC business relationships and Fraud Risks, such as anesthesia agreements and physician-owned equipment companies
  • Impact of recent Stark Law and Anti-Kickback Statute changes

Lisa Pretus, Esquire

The Pretus Law Group

Who Are the People in Your ASC?

A Compliance Talk About the People That You Meet Each Day

This presentation will focus on compliance and regulatory developments affecting the people that you meet each day: surgery center patients, employees, and providers. Subjects will include:

  • Patient privacy enforcement trends, cybersecurity, and regulatory changes on the horizon every administrator should be aware of
  • Recent Enforcement Actions re: onboarding providers and staff
  • New trends and regulatory developments in workplace health and safety
